U.S. agrees to temporarily lift Iran oil sanctions amid progress in negotiations

The U.S. Treasury Department issued a two-month license for Iran to produce, sell and deliver oil without placing U.S. penalties on buyers. The agreement is in exchange for what the White House called progress in negotiations. Weijia Jiang reports.
